jetson nano 内核移植
时间: 2023-08-30 15:12:05 浏览: 140
关于Jetson Nano内核移植的问题,以下是一般的步骤:
1. 获取源码:首先,你需要获取Jetson Nano所使用的内核源码。你可以在NVIDIA官方网站上找到相应版本的源码。
2. 确定目标内核版本:根据你的需求,确定你想要移植的内核版本。可以选择基于主线Linux内核的版本,或者选择NVIDIA提供的特定版本。
3. 配置交叉编译环境:为了能够在主机上编译适用于Jetson Nano的内核,你需要设置交叉编译环境。该环境将使用为ARM架构生成的工具链。
4. 修改配置:根据你的需求,修改内核配置文件。这些配置文件位于源码根目录下的.config文件中。你可以使用make menuconfig等命令来进行配置。
5. 编译内核:使用交叉编译环境编译内核。这通常涉及到执行make命令,并使用指定的交叉编译工具链。
6. 生成镜像:生成内核镜像文件。这通常是一个可引导的Image文件或者uImage文件。
7. 制作启动介质:将生成的内核镜像文件烧录到启动介质(如SD卡)上。确保正确配置启动介质以引导Jetson Nano。
请注意,以上步骤提供了一个大致的指导,实际操作中可能会有一些细微差异。在进行内核移植之前,建议你查阅相关的文档和教程,以确保正确理解和执行每个步骤。
相关问题
Jetson nano Jetson nano + opencv jetson TX2 jetson Xavier NX Jetson AGX Xavier参数对比
Jetson Nano:CPU:Quad-core ARM A57,GPU:128-core Maxwell,内存:4GB 64-bit LPDDR4,存储:MicroSD,连接:Gigabit Ethernet,外设:HDMI,USB 3.0,MIPI CSI。
Jetson TX2:CPU:Dual-core Denver 2 + Quad-core ARM A57,GPU:256-core Pascal,内存:8GB 128-bit LPDDR4,存储:32GB eMMC,连接:Gigabit Ethernet,外设:HDMI,USB 3.0,MIPI CSI。
Jetson Xavier NX:CPU:6-core Carmel ARM,GPU:384-core Volta,内存:8GB 128-bit LPDDR4,存储:32GB eMMC,连接:Gigabit Ethernet,外设:HDMI,USB 3.0,MIPI CSI。
Jetson AGX Xavier:CPU:8-core Carmel ARM,GPU:512-core Volta,内存:16GB 256-bit LPDDR4,存储:32GB eMMC,连接:Gigabit Ethernet,外设:HDMI,USB 3.0,MIPI CSI。
Jetson nano
Jetson Nano是由NVIDIA推出的一款小型人工智能计算机,主要面向学生、爱好者和开发者。它采用了NVIDIA的Jetson平台,配备了四核ARM Cortex-A57处理器和128核NVIDIA Maxwell GPU,可以运行各种深度学习框架,如TensorFlow、PyTorch和Caffe等。它还支持高清视频编解码、图像处理和传感器数据采集等功能,非常适合用于机器人、自动驾驶、智能摄像头等应用场景。
阅读全文